Transaction 7350394bcd2d4aad3ec6f84191f9789609ac9ef21a8f650ced512a674eb1c900
1 Input
1 Output
-
7350394bcd2d4aad3ec6f84191f9789609ac9ef21a8f650ced512a674eb1c900:0
- value
- 39995405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6522a446b24dc4cae8d86706a55d6cc09519bdd OP_EQUAL
- address
- 3Q9SafZjazMoKpCjvo3xksEuuD72wf2rUj